내비게이션이 최적의 길을 찾는 원리는 무엇인가요?
내비게이션이나 어플에 길찾기를 하면 최적의 루트대로 안내를 해주는데요.
그렇게 최적의 길을 찾는 원리가 어떤 것인지 궁금합니다.
감사합니다.
안녕하세요. 전기기사 취득 후 현업에서 일하고 있는 4년차 전기 엔지니어 입니다.
내비게이션에서 최적의 길을 찾는 원리는 주로 그래프 이론과 알고리즘에 기반합니다. 일반적으로 다익스트라(Dijkstra)나 A* 알고리즘 같은 경로 탐색 알고리즘을 사용해 최단거리 또는 최단시간 경로를 계산합니다. 이 알고리즘들은 도로망을 그래프로 표현하고 가중치를 부여해 현재 위치에서 목적지까지의 최적 경로를 탐색합니다. 교통 상황 데이터나 도로 공사 정보, 실시간 교통량도 반영해 더 효율적인 경로를 제안합니다. 이런 정보들을 통해 내비게이션은 다양한 변수들을 고려해 최적의 경로를 안내하는 것입니다.
안녕하세요. 전기전자 분야 전문가입니다.
내비게이션이 최적의 길을 찾는 데는 여러 알고리즘과 데이터가 활용됩니다. 주로 사용하는 알고리즘은 다익스트라 알고리즘과 A* 알고리즘입니다. 이 알고리즘들은 다양한 경로와 교통 정보를 바탕으로 가장 빠른 길, 짧은 길, 혹은 사용자가 선호하는 설정에 맞춰 경로를 계산합니다. 실시간 교통 상황, 도로 공사 정보, 사고 정보 등도 반영되어 변동성이 높은 환경에서도 신뢰성 있는 결과를 제공할 수 있도록 설계되어 있습니다. GPS 데이터를 지속적으로 수집하면서 이러한 정보를 지속적으로 업데이트하여 가능한 최적의 경로를 제공합니다.
좋은 하루 보내시고 저의 답변이 도움이 되셨길 바랍니다 :)
안녕하세요. 서인엽 전문가입니다.
내비게이션 시스템이 최적의 경로를 찾는 원리는 다양한 알고리즘과 기술을 기반으로 합니다. 이 원리는 주로 경로 탐색 알고리즘을 사용하여 도로망 내에서 가장 효율적인 경로를 계산하는 것입니다. 아래에서 내비게이션 시스템이 최적의 길을 찾는 주요 원리와 관련된 기술을 설명하겠습니다.
1. 지도 데이터와 그래프 모델내비게이션 시스템은 도로와 교차로, 교차로 간의 거리 및 소요 시간 등의 정보를 포함한 지도를 기반으로 동작합니다. 이 지도는 그래프 모델로 표현되며, 이 모델에서 노드는 교차로를, 엣지는 도로를 나타냅니다. 각 엣지는 도로의 길이, 제한 속도, 교통 상황 등의 정보를 포함하고 있습니다.
2. 경로 탐색 알고리즘내비게이션 시스템은 다음과 같은 경로 탐색 알고리즘을 사용하여 최적의 경로를 찾습니다:
다익스트라 알고리즘 (Dijkstra's Algorithm): 그래프의 모든 노드에서 시작하여 각 노드까지의 최단 거리를 계산합니다. 모든 노드를 방문하여 최단 경로를 찾기 때문에, 일반적으로 정확하지만 계산량이 많습니다.
A 알고리즘 (A Algorithm)**: 다익스트라 알고리즘의 확장으로, 휴리스틱(추정값)을 사용하여 탐색 속도를 개선합니다. A* 알고리즘은 현재 노드에서 목표 노드까지의 예상 거리를 고려하여 탐색을 더 효율적으로 진행합니다. 이 방법은 길찾기에서 많이 사용됩니다.
벨만-포드 알고리즘 (Bellman-Ford Algorithm): 음수 가중치를 가진 엣지가 있을 때 유용한 알고리즘입니다. 하지만 다익스트라 알고리즘보다 계산이 느릴 수 있습니다.
최적의 경로를 찾기 위해 내비게이션 시스템은 실시간 교통 정보를 활용합니다. 이는 도로의 현재 교통량, 사고 정보, 공사 등의 데이터입니다. 이 정보를 통해 예상 소요 시간이 변동될 수 있으며, 실시간 교통 상황에 따라 경로를 동적으로 조정합니다.
4. 경로 최적화단순 최단 거리: 기본적으로는 가장 짧은 거리의 경로를 찾습니다.
최소 시간: 교통량과 속도 제한을 고려하여 가장 빠른 경로를 선택합니다.
경제적인 경로: 연료 소모를 최소화하기 위한 경로를 선택할 수 있습니다.
사용자는 우회 도로 회피, 고속도로 우선 등의 선호 설정을 통해 경로 탐색을 개인화할 수 있습니다. 내비게이션 시스템은 이러한 사용자 설정을 반영하여 최적의 경로를 제시합니다.
6. 다중 경로 옵션내비게이션 시스템은 종종 여러 경로 옵션을 제공하여 사용자가 선택할 수 있도록 합니다. 이 옵션들은 시간, 거리, 교통 상황 등을 고려하여 제시됩니다.
종합적으로내비게이션 시스템은 지도 데이터와 경로 탐색 알고리즘, 실시간 교통 정보, 사용자 선호도 등을 통합하여 최적의 경로를 찾습니다. 이러한 기술을 통해 사용자는 효율적이고 정확한 길 안내를 받을 수 있습니다.
안녕하세요. 김재훈 전문가입니다.
네비게이션이 최적의 길을 찾는 원리는 다양한 요소를 고려한 복잡한 알고리즘에 기반합니다. 대표적으로는 다익스트라 알고리즘과 같은 최단 경로 알고리즘을 사용하여 출발지에서 목적지까지 가장 빠른 길을 계산합니다. 여기에 실시간 교통 정보 도로 상태 사용자의 선호도 등을 종합적으로 분석하여 더욱 정확하고 효율적인 경로를 제시합니다. 예를 들어 실시간 교통 정보를 통해 정체 구간을 피하고, 사용자의 선호도에 따라 고속도로 우선 또는 일반도로 우선 등을 선택할 수 있습니다.
안녕하세요. 강세훈 전문가입니다.
실시간 교통정보를 통해 최적거리가 판단이 가능한 것입니다.
또한 수많은 알고리즘을 통해, 최적거리를 순식간에 판단하려
아주 노력을 하는 시스템이지요. 특히 가장 중요한 것은
급작스런 사고를 막는 겁니다.
감사합니다.